Transaction 7510ca169e92fe569854fa286cdff602656b131cef202fde1f99b5a870a39d6b

2 Input
2 Outputs
  • 7510ca169e92fe569854fa286cdff602656b131cef202fde1f99b5a870a39d6b:0
  • value  61000
    address  32MLRpiLEgTAku9Bn9BbuAK92puw3VWVUG
  • 7510ca169e92fe569854fa286cdff602656b131cef202fde1f99b5a870a39d6b:1
  • value  214528
    address  12yNoffdL77SauJxD6bAS2ABvVWhMdvHBU